Hi Lucy, i agree with Zeb, if you are concerned it may be something other than ibs please go see your doctor again and stress this to them. If it is ibs then you may need to look at what you eat to help control it. On advice from the hospital i cut out deadly nightshade group of foods, white potato, tomatoes, peppers. Also white bread, cakes, anything with white flour in it, white pasta, white rice, reducing gluten intake. This has stopped almost all violent stomach spasms, as well as constant and sudden trips to toilet. Good luck i hope you find some relief soon.

Yes I also have IBS, it is strange how many people with fibro have it. Mine is normally worse low down on the left hand side around groin area but strangely enough if it goes to the righhand side and further up I always know I am going to have a proper flare. It is horrible that feeling of wanting to go and then not being able to. I have gone onto decaff coffee and that helps and I keep off sliced white bread, things like shop bought muffins and unfortunately because I love fruit I just stick to two portions. Since I have been on Pregablin for the neuropathic pain my IBS has never been so severe as it was and some days I am fine. Do have a word with your doctor though as anything so severe really needs to be looked at. Let us know how you get on. Big hugsx
